About the Authors

The TINY BIRD SONG Illustrator ­
CHERIE NOWLIN MCBRIDE (AKA
Duckie) grew up in a small town on the
industrial Texas Gulf Coast. Her
mother would have preferred that she
become a teacher, but she managed
to “get away to art school.”
Art school paid off and soon! She went
on to help produce the original
Houston Astro­dome scoreboard
animations and then became a .
filmmaker in Alaska. Later, she re­
turned to her hometown to join the
family business.
Life refocused to intensive art when
Cherie and Glenn McBride married in
1985. Both feeling cloistered with
business careers, they plunged into
night school pottery classes. The open-
ended creative feeling of molding fresh
clay and firing pots changed their lives
forever.
In 2000, Cherie began painting and
showing nature art at festivals. By
2004, the “creative couple” had
decided to develop a series of “tiny
bird songs” - illustrated nature poetry
for posters, calendars, books and
planners. The purpose would be to
heighten awareness and feelings for
art, wild birds and nature around the
globe.

The TINY BIRD SONG Poet ­
GLENN NELSON MCBRIDE (AKA the
Grackle) grew up as the only son of a
blacksmith in the small town of
Bluegrove, Texas. Not caring for
“basketball high school,” he joined the
USMC at age 17. While overseas, he
became intrigued by stories about the
determination and success of Pablo
Picasso and vowed to enter college
one day to learn more of art and
literature. Then after 4 years service,
this U.S. Marine (now in the reserves)
found himself sitting in class at
Midwestern University and suffering
serious nosebleeds while listening to
the overwhelming lines of Keats,
Shelly, Dickinson and other great
poets.
At age 39, Glenn finally received a
degree at the University of Houston/
CLC, continuing on to complete
graduate studies in behavioral
sciences. In his fifties, he became a
founding member of the Brazosport,
Texas Poets Society. Now in his sixties
and realizing the mindless destruction
of our natural environment, “the
Grackle,” along with his wife “Duckie,”
has focused on “awesome nature” and
the outdoors - through their Tiny Bird
Songs.
